🔍 Key Features:
Blade: Stiga Allround Wood (original 5-ply, vintage handle shape and font)
Rubbers: Authentic Butterfly Sriver D-13-S, Made in Japan (original rubbers still applied, 1970s–80s design)
Handle: Straight handle with vintage grain, bottom stamped with “földy” logo – possibly a regional distributor or exclusive club edition
Estimated Era: Late 1970s to early 1980s
Condition: Very good vintage condition with natural aging, minor wear on rubber and edge – excellent for display or nostalgic hardbat-style play
